Description

For every parent tired of telling their kids to PLEASE JUST GET ALONG, this hilarious and imaginative new picture book--from the beloved creators of Babymouse--is here to help. Sort of.

Meet the Evil Princess and the Brave Knight. She casts terrible spells, while he fights dragons. He rescues cats in distress, while she makes mischief. No wonder there isn't much peace in this kingdom! But is the Evil Princess really so evil? And is the Brave Knight truly as chivalrous as he seems? Children and parents will laugh at seeing familiar family dynamics play out in this charming and imaginative new story.

The Evil Princess vs. the Brave Knight (Book 1)

Product form

£15.75

Includes FREE delivery
Usually despatched within 12 days
Hardback by Jennifer L. Holm , Matthew Holm

2 in stock

Short Description:

For every parent tired of telling their kids to PLEASE JUST GET ALONG, this hilarious and imaginative new picture book--from... Read more

    Publisher: Random House USA Inc
    Publication Date: 06/08/2019
    ISBN13: 9781524771348, 978-1524771348
    ISBN10: 1524771341

    Number of Pages: 40

    Children & Teen , Teen & Young Adult

    Description

    For every parent tired of telling their kids to PLEASE JUST GET ALONG, this hilarious and imaginative new picture book--from the beloved creators of Babymouse--is here to help. Sort of.

    Meet the Evil Princess and the Brave Knight. She casts terrible spells, while he fights dragons. He rescues cats in distress, while she makes mischief. No wonder there isn't much peace in this kingdom! But is the Evil Princess really so evil? And is the Brave Knight truly as chivalrous as he seems? Children and parents will laugh at seeing familiar family dynamics play out in this charming and imaginative new story.

    Customer Reviews

    Be the first to write a review
    0%
    (0)
    0%
    (0)
    0%
    (0)
    0%
    (0)
    0%
    (0)

    Recently viewed products

    © 2025 Book Curl,

      • American Express
      • Apple Pay
      • Diners Club
      • Discover
      • Google Pay
      • Maestro
      • Mastercard
      • PayPal
      • Shop Pay
      • Union Pay
      • Visa

      Login

      Forgot your password?

      Don't have an account yet?
      Create account